Revised Schedule of the M/V Caroline Voyager The sailing schedule of the M/V Caroline Voyager was delayed from its original scheduled to sail on Saturday, October 24th, 2009, due to several unexpected reasons. The first is due to the holiday (UN Day) on Friday, October 23, 2009, and the weekend, causing the bunkering/fueling of the ship to not be completed, including the loading of some cargo. In addition, there were some problems with the ship’s refrigeration system, which is needed in order to keep the H1N1 flu vaccines refrigerated during the trip. Therefore, the sailing schedule has been postponed until Thursday, October 29, 2009 to make sure that everything is ready. In order to ensure that the refrigeration system is working properly, Mr. Leo Lokopwe, the Department of Transportation, Communication & Infrastructure’s Branch Development Manager, will accompany the ship to monitor the system. Mr. Lokopwe is assisting the crew on behalf of the Chief Engineer, Mr. Mariano Kilmete, who is currently on vacation.
